What a pixelated dashboard display usually looks like
Pixel failure is not always as obvious as a completely blank screen. You may see missing sections of letters, numbers that disappear when the cabin is warm, vertical or horizontal lines through the display, or a screen that works intermittently when the dashboard is tapped or the vehicle goes over a bump.
The fault commonly affects the centre information display within the instrument cluster. Depending on the vehicle, that screen may show mileage, time, outside temperature, warning messages, radio information, gear position, trip data or service prompts. When pixels fail, important information can become unreadable even though the speedometer and other gauges still appear to work normally.
A pixelated display should not be confused with a dim backlight. A dim display is visible but poorly illuminated, especially at night. Pixel loss leaves parts of characters or graphics permanently missing, distorted or flickering. The distinction matters because the repair method is different.
Why dashboard pixels fail
Instrument clusters live in a harsh environment. They are exposed to heat from direct sunlight, cold starts, vibration, electrical fluctuations and years of use. Over time, the flexible ribbon connection between the LCD and the cluster circuit board can deteriorate. On other units, the LCD panel itself fails, or a fault develops within the display driver circuitry.
Heat is often a useful clue. If the display is worse after the car has been parked in the sun, then improves when cold, a failing ribbon connection or ageing display components are likely. If the fault is present all the time and gradually spreads, the LCD may be reaching the end of its service life.
Water ingress can also cause display faults, particularly where a leaking windscreen, blocked scuttle drains or a damp interior has affected electrical components. In this situation, it is worth finding and resolving the source of moisture as well as repairing the cluster. Otherwise, the replacement display or repaired electronics may be exposed to the same problem again.
How to fix a pixelated dashboard display properly
The first step is to confirm that the cluster is the cause. Check whether the display brightness can be adjusted and whether the fault changes with the ignition position, headlights on or off, or cabin temperature. A weak vehicle battery can create unusual warning lights and temporary display behaviour, but it does not usually cause a consistent pattern of missing pixels.
If the vehicle has other electrical symptoms, such as non-functioning gauges, intermittent warning lights, loss of communication or repeated fault codes, the issue may extend beyond the LCD. A proper diagnostic assessment is then needed before any display repair is carried out.
For a genuine pixel fault, the instrument cluster normally needs to be removed, opened carefully and inspected. The repair may involve replacing the LCD screen, renewing the ribbon connection or repairing the circuit that drives the display. The exact procedure varies by make, model and year. An Audi cluster, for example, may have a different display design and known failure point from a Ford, Fiat, Alfa Romeo or Aston Martin unit.
Once repaired, the cluster should be tested under controlled conditions before it is refitted. This is where specialist equipment matters. Testing with an emulator allows the repaired unit to be checked for display operation, warning functions and gauge behaviour without relying solely on a quick vehicle test. It also helps identify faults that were hidden by the original display failure.
Why a DIY pixel repair can be a false economy
Online guides often suggest pressing the display ribbon, reheating connections or fitting a low-cost replacement screen. These methods can sometimes create a short-term improvement, but they carry real risks. Instrument clusters contain delicate needles, coded electronics and fragile circuit tracks. A small mistake can turn a display-only issue into a complete cluster failure.
There is also the question of correct parts. Screens that look similar may have different pin layouts, resolutions, polarising layers or driver requirements. An incorrect LCD can show reversed colours, poor contrast, incomplete characters or no display at all. Adhesives and ribbon bonding also need to be applied accurately and cleanly to remain reliable through changing temperatures.
Removing the cluster itself is another point where care is needed. Trim panels, airbag-related areas and steering column covers can be damaged if the correct procedure is not followed. On some vehicles, disconnecting or reconnecting the unit incorrectly may store fault codes or create additional warning messages.
A DIY approach may be reasonable for an experienced electronics technician working on a non-critical spare unit. For most drivers and garages, professional cluster repair is the more predictable route. It protects the original unit and avoids the cost, programming delays and mileage concerns that can come with a replacement dashboard.
When replacement is not the answer
A main dealer may recommend fitting a new instrument cluster. This can be appropriate where the casing is severely damaged, the electronics are beyond economical repair or the correct replacement process is required by the manufacturer. However, it is not automatically necessary for pixel loss.
A replacement cluster can involve ordering delays, coding, immobiliser matching and mileage configuration. It may also leave the owner with a unit that no longer matches the vehicle’s original equipment history. For trade customers, it can keep a customer’s vehicle occupying workshop space longer than it should.
Repairing the original unit generally means its existing mileage and coding are retained. It is also a more economical option when the fault is limited to the screen or its associated electronics. The key is accurate diagnosis first. If the cluster has multiple failures, the repair should address the underlying cause rather than simply fitting a new LCD and hoping for the best.
Checks to make before booking a repair
A clear description of the fault helps identify the likely repair quickly. Note whether the pixels disappear only when warm, whether the screen is completely blank or partially readable, and whether gauges or warning lights are affected at the same time. A photograph of the display with the ignition on can be useful, particularly where the fault is intermittent.
Have the vehicle details ready, including make, model, year and registration. The cluster part number can help where it is accessible, but do not remove the unit just to find it unless you are confident with the process. For garages, include any diagnostic fault codes and the results of basic battery and charging checks.
Do not ignore safety-related messages simply because the display is difficult to read. If the vehicle is showing a brake, airbag, engine oil pressure or charging-system warning, stop and investigate the warning according to the vehicle handbook. Restoring pixels makes the message visible again, but it does not remove a genuine fault elsewhere on the vehicle.
